The Torah is the foundational text of the Jewish people, traditionally comprising the first five books of the Hebrew Bible: Genesis , Exodus , Leviticus , Numbers , and Deuteronomy . Beyond its religious significance, it serves as a historical and cultural anchor that has preserved Jewish identity through centuries of displacement, persecution, and change.
